Technology Empowering Individuals
The rise of renewable energy sources is not merely a result of environmental concerns; it’s also driven by technological advancements that empower individuals and communities. Here are some groundbreaking technologies that are reshaping the energy landscape:
1. Energy Storage Solutions
One of the challenges of renewable energy sources like solar and wind power is their intermittency. Energy storage solutions, such as advanced batteries, are bridging the gap. These batteries store excess energy generated during sunny or windy days for use during periods of low energy production. This technology gives individuals more control over their energy supply, reducing their reliance on electric companies.
2. Smart Grids: The Backbone of Energy Independence
Smart grids are transforming the way we distribute and consume electricity. They enable real-time monitoring and control of energy usage. With a smart grid in place, consumers can optimize their energy consumption and even sell excess energy back to the grid. This not only reduces energy bills but challenges the traditional role of electric companies as sole providers.
Taking Action: How You Can Make a Difference
Now that we’ve explored the various facets of the energy revolution, it’s time to discuss actionable steps you can take to assert your control over your energy future. Here’s what you can do:
1. Invest in Renewable Energy Systems
Consider installing solar panels, wind turbines, or geothermal systems on your property. While the initial investment might seem significant, the long-term savings and reduced reliance on electric companies make it a worthwhile endeavor.
2. Embrace Energy Efficiency
Make your home or business more energy-efficient. This includes upgrading insulation, using energy-efficient appliances, and adopting LED lighting. By reducing your energy consumption, you can minimize your reliance on electric companies.
3. Explore Community Energy Initiatives
Many communities are coming together to establish local renewable energy projects. Joining such initiatives allows you to contribute to clean energy production and reduce your dependence on traditional electric grids.
4. Advocate for Renewable Energy Policies
Get involved in advocating for renewable energy policies at the local, state, or national level. Support legislation that promotes clean energy production and provides incentives for individuals and businesses to adopt renewable technologies.
